Specification of the job

The Microfinance Field Specialist will assist the Microfinance Advisor and be responsible for implementing STARS program microfinance related activities. The job holder will be responsible for executing all the activities of the microfinance program including product development, pilot testing, capacity building, pilot monitoring and managing relationships with MFI partners & consultants. S/He will advise and consult in all the technical details of the new product development.

Reporting Relationships

The Microfinance Field Specialist will be part of a small team of the STARS project office in Ethiopia. The Microfinance Field Specialist reports to the Microfinance Advisor. The four country teams will be part of a bigger project team managed from Rwanda.

Job Summary/Overall goal of the position

The Microfinance Field Specialist will support the Microfinance advisor and be responsible for implementation of the agri-finance product development and value chain finance interventions under the STARS program.

Duties and responsibilities

  • Support in needs assessment, feasibility study for new products and product development.
  • Training & coaching of loan officers to implement the newly designed loan product
  • Conduct a regular visit to pilot branches to provide one-on-one support and coaching services to loan officers
  • Support MFIs on pilot testing and monitoring of the new credit products (agri-loan and value chain products) and follow up to monitoring and documenting the progress of pilot branches, including IT solutions for agri-lending and monitoring at branch and head office level
  • Following up and assist MFIs to meet their target
  • Collect and store all MFI portfolio information and performance indicators. Facilitate MFIs MicroScore assessment, external rating, portfolio audit, reporting to MIX market, etc.
  • Support MFI to have a gender strategy
  • Ensure the linkage between value chain development and value chain finance
  • Support MFI in their saving mobilization efforts
  • Support the design and implementation of BDS and barefoot BDS models
  • Reporting and communication; Monitoring and evaluation of lending Progress
  • Document lessons learned, write case stories and replicable best practices for replication and dissemination
  • Facilitate and coordinate logistic arrangement for any field works, survey, impact assessment, workshops and training activities
  • Support in MFI analysis/due diligence for refinancing of MFIs (data collection, assessment, preparing documents for financiers) and monitoring of outstanding loans to MFIs and guarantees.
  • Key Result Areas
  • MFI Microscore assessment and external rating
  • Partnership between MFI and refinancing agencies
  • Capacity building of MFIs to access the agri-finance products and to implement crop specific lending products

Deliverables

  • Work plan for Microfinance activities for the programme (annual, quarterly)
  • Work plan per MFI and per intervention in the programme 2016-2020
  • Dashboard for MFI performance quarterly
  • Quarterly report for Microfinance activities
  • Success story from the partners of Microfinance activities for communication every quarter.
  • Learning report contribution for Microfinance activities
  • Report from the Microfinance Consultant for the MFI product development
  • Report of workshop Microfinance activities
